Custom Air Handlers: Design and Specifications for Data Centers in 2022
In this webinar we look at the process of effectively specifying and designing a modern computer room air handler. We concentrate our discussion on thermal performance and physical characteristics, as well as address best design practices with an emphasis on tradeoffs concerning air flow, waterside pressure drop, fan selection, and unit footprint.
We also look at effectively communicating the engineer's intent by clearly specifying such things as:
- CFM and capacity adjusted for air density at design conditions and location
- Electrical characteristics such as power limitations, dual power capabilities, KAIC fusing and harmonic mitigation
- General construction characteristics such as metal gauge, insulation, and maintenance clearances
- Waterside pressure limitations and control valve selections
- Digital communication requirements
- Seismic requirements
- Any state, local, or municipal code requirements
- Testing and validation requirements
